Moore, Doris Langley to "Skipper" [Thomas Tucker], 1932-06-09
Item — Box: 2, Folder: 8
Identifier: 2005.002.1.2.8.059
Scope and Contents
Transcribed copy of the original letter.
Scope and Contents
"Dear Skipper, Once more I have occasion to send you thanks. It is a pity I must give you so much trouble, but there doesn't seem any way of avoiding it. I have just finished Dormant, and I enjoyed it thoroughly, and thought it better than The Red House. In fact it kept me awake at night..."
